Overview Dovion 2mg Syrup

PediaNausea 2mg Syrup is a pediatric medication used to alleviate nausea and vomiting. It's primarily prescribed for nausea and vomiting related to surgery, chemotherapy, radiation therapy, and gastrointestinal infections. It also addresses vomiting induced by medications such as analgesics. PediaNausea 2mg Syrup can be administered before or after meals. For chemotherapy-induced vomiting, administer 30 minutes prior to treatment. For radiation therapy, give it 1-2 hours beforehand, and 1 hour before surgery to prevent post-procedure vomiting. If your child vomits the medication within 30 minutes, soothe them and repeat the dose. Avoid doubling the dose if it's nearing the next scheduled administration. PediaNausea 2mg Syrup might cause temporary side effects like headache, constipation, diarrhea, and tiredness. These typically resolve as your child adjusts to the medication. If side effects persist or worsen, consult your pediatrician immediately. Disclose all medications your child takes, including pain relievers, antibiotics, and antidepressants. Also, inform the doctor of any liver or kidney issues, gastrointestinal obstructions, heart conditions, or allergies to medications, ingredients, or foods. This is crucial for proper dosage and treatment planning.

How Dovion 2mg Syrup works:

Prior to procedures like radiotherapy, chemotherapy, abdominal surgery, or other significant operations, dying cells release serotonin into the bloodstream. This triggers the body's emetic centers, potentially causing nausea and vomiting in your child. Administering 2mg of Dovion Syrup preemptively inhibits serotonin's action on these brain centers, thus preventing vomiting.

SAFETY ADVICE

KidneyKid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ED

Dovion 2mg Syrup poses no safety concerns for patients with renal impairment; no dosage modification is necessary.

LiverLiverCAUTION

Patients with liver impairment should use Dovion 2mg Syrup cautiously, potentially requiring a modified dosage. Physician consultation is recommended. For significant hepatic dysfunction, the prescribed dose should not be exceeded, and pediatric patients should be under a doctor's care.

What if you forget to take Dovion 2mg Syrup :

Remain calm. Administer the omitted dose upon recollection. If the next dose is imminent, however, forgo the missed one. Avoid doubling the dose; adhere strictly to the recommended medication schedule.

FAQs on Dovion 2mg Syrup

Dovion 2mg Syrup helps prevent vomiting in children before major surgery, chemotherapy, or radiotherapy. Doctors may also prescribe it to treat vomiting from stomach illnesses. For optimal results, always follow the prescribed dosage.
Accidental overdose of Dovion 2mg Syrup is unlikely to be harmful, but contact your child's doctor immediately. Excessive Dovion 2mg Syrup can, however, cause serious side effects including drowsiness, agitation, rapid heart rate, high blood pressure, flushing, dilated pupils, sweating, muscle spasms, involuntary eye movements, hyperreflexia, and seizures (collectively known as serotonin syndrome). Seek immediate medical attention if any of these occur.
Store Dovion 2mg Syrup at room temperature, in a dry place, protected from direct heat and light. Keep it out of children's reach and sight.
Dovion 2mg Syrup may interact with other medications. Inform your child's doctor about all other medications your child is taking before administering Dovion 2mg Syrup. Always consult your child's doctor before giving your child any medication.
Seek immediate medical attention for your child if they exhibit serotonin syndrome symptoms such as rapid or irregular heartbeat, greenish vomit, constipation, pale skin and eyes, dark urine, agitation, and sleeplessness.
Do not give your child Dovion 2mg Syrup with medications for depression or migraine; this combination can cause serotonin syndrome. Always consult your child's doctor before administering any medication.
